Bekhruz Mirzayev is the Head of the Department of Environmental Diplomacy and Green Economy Projects at the Ministry of Energy of the Republic of Uzbekistan. With a strong background in renewable energy, green economy development, and carbon market coordination, he has held senior roles in both the Ministry of Energy and the Ministry of Economy and Finance. He plays a key role in national and international low-carbon initiatives, coordinating with partners such as Japan, Korea, ADB, GIZ, and the World Bank on projects like the Joint Credit Mechanism (JCM), iCRAFTY, and MRV system development. Bekhruz holds a master’s degree from D.I. Mendeleev Russian Chemical-Technological University and a bachelor’s in industrial economy from the Tashkent University of Chemical Technologies, and is currently pursuing a PhD in green economy transition. A published researcher and certified expert in sustainable investment and energy management, he also lectures on green growth, ESG, and carbon trading mechanisms.
